How to play How Well Do You Know Me?
- Predict your score out of 15 before you start. Write it down.
- Both write your answers to every question privately.
- Compare and score a point per match.
- Compare the real score with your prediction.
Why couples love this game
Confidence about a partner rises with time together while accuracy does not, because people stop updating. A scored quiz makes the gap visible in about ten minutes, and every question you get wrong is a small piece of information you had missing.

Frequently asked questions
How well should you know your partner?
Better than most people do, and less well than most people think. Confidence rises with time together while accuracy does not, because couples stop updating what they know.
What is a good score?
Ten or eleven out of fifteen is typical. The more interesting number is the one you predicted before starting — that gap is the actual result.
